将字符串与二维数组进行比较
Comparing a string to a two-dimensional array
我这里有一些奇怪的js源代码,它将字符串与二维数组进行比较:
secret = new Array(2);
secret[0]= new Array(2);
secret[1]= new Array(2);
secret[0][0] = 'A';
secret[0][1] = 'B';
secret[1][0] = 'C';
secret[1][1] = 'D';
pwd=prompt("Password: ","");
if (pwd==secret){
alert("Right!");
}
else{
alert("Wrong!");
}
js是如何进行比较的?是将数组转换为字符串还是反过来?
数组隐式转换为字符串"A,B,C,D"
。
相关文章:
- 作为一个二维数组,从ajax接收
- 创建P5.js二维数组
- 如何在Javascript中从select标记的一系列选项中构建二维数组
- inArray,indexOf在二维数组中
- 比较二维数组js
- 从二维数组中获取img src和img维度,并在body中显示
- 如何在Java Script中比较二维数组和一维数组,并将常见数据存储在另一个数组中
- 如何将以下字符串拆分为二维数组:
- 更新Aurelia中二维数组的视图
- 如何在JavaScript中拆分二维数组
- 在二维数组中搜索比嵌套循环更有效的方法
- 无法访问javascript中二维数组中的第二个字段
- 将一个二维数组传递给javascript中的函数
- 无法在 Javascript 中访问我的二维数组
- 将二维数组转换为单个数组
- 将一个数组与javascript中的二维数组进行比较
- JavaScript二维数组
- 将二维数组中的 ID 与另一个二维数组中的 ID 进行比较
- 将字符串与二维数组进行比较
- 比较二维数组和一维数组并删除匹配项(JavaScript)